Terms Used In Florida Statutes 738.101

  • Income: means money or property that a fiduciary receives as current return from a principal asset. See Florida Statutes 738.102
  • Principal: means property held in trust for distribution to a remainder beneficiary when the trust terminates. See Florida Statutes 738.102
This chapter may be cited as the “Florida Uniform Principal and Income Act.”
